Subject: Handover — telemetry compression

Taking over from me: zstd rollout on the Pulsewire telemetry pipeline is at 40%. Dictionary retraining job runs nightly; if ratios drop below 3:1, the Flarecheck alert fires. Don't bump compression level past 6 — collector CPU redlines. Rollback flag is pulsewire.compress.legacy. Open questions are in the handover doc. For anything unclear, mail the pipeline rotation at the address below.

pager mailbox: silael.sorwyn.tamius@zemvarsys.corp

TURN-208: Gatevale turnstile counters at the Merrow Field pilot double-count when a rotation reverses mid-cycle. Attendance totals drift roughly 2% high per event. The debounce window fix is implemented, reviewed by Ilsa, and soak-tested across two simulated match days without drift. Ready for your cut; the candidate build is identified below.

trace token, tagag-tafog: htk6_5ed18c

Quarterly Planning Note — Heads of Department

Quick update on the Darnstead factory question. We've run the numbers on adding a third line versus extending shifts, and honestly the shift extension wins on flexibility, at least through next year. Tooling lead times are the wildcard — Provek quoted longer than hoped. We'll finalize at the ops review next month. The confidential capacity strategy this feeds into is laid out below.

internal memo for kawip-hadug: Headcount on the Wenwyn team goes from 7 to 140 by the end of January. Gross margin on Wenwyn came in at 20 percent against a plan of 15 percent.

## Deep-Link Routing On-Call Notes — Wayfinch Mobile

Wayfinch routes deep links through the Linkhall resolver before handing off to the native app. If users report links opening the web fallback, check the resolver's route manifest first — a stale manifest is the most common cause. Redeploying the manifest requires a signed bundle; unsigned bundles are silently rejected, which can look like a caching issue. Build the bundle with the standard script, then sign it using the deploy key that follows.

deploy key for kajof-fajop: bky6_gDHw9Q